Material Costs - Engineered siding installation costs typically range from $2 to $7 per square foot, depending on the material chosen. For example, vinyl-engineered siding might be around $2 to $4 per square foot, while fiber-cement options could be $5 to $7. These prices reflect the material expenses paid to local contractors or suppliers.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for engineered siding installation generally fall between $1.50 and $4 per square foot. The total can vary based on the project's complexity and local labor rates, with larger or more intricate jobs tending to be on the higher end of the range.
Project Size Impact - Larger siding projects tend to have a lower cost per square foot due to economies of scale, with total costs often ranging from $3,000 to $12,000 for typical residential homes. Smaller projects or partial siding replacements may fall toward the lower end of this spectrum.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as removal of existing siding, surface preparation, or trim installation can add $500 to $2,500 to the overall cost. Local pros provide estimates that include or exclude these additional services based on project scope.
